#include <Keypad.h>
#include <LiquidCrystal_I2C.h>
#include <Servo.h>
const uint8_t row = 4;
const uint8_t column = 4;
char keys[row][column] = {
{'1', '2', '3', 'A'},
{'4', '5', '6', 'B'},
{'7', '8', '9', 'C'},
{'*', '0', '#', 'D'}
};
uint8_t columns[column] = {5, 4, 3, 2};
uint8_t rows[row] = {9, 8, 7, 6};
Keypad keypad = Keypad( makeKeymap(keys), rows, columns, row, column);
LiquidCrystal_I2C lcd(0x27, 16 ,2);
Servo monCerveau;
int redLed = 13;
int greenLed = 12;
String code = "4568";
String attempt = "";
int lenght = 0;
void setup() {
Serial.begin(9600);
lcd.init();
lcd.backlight();
lcd.setCursor(0,0);
lcd.print("Password : ");
monCerveau.attach(10);
monCerveau.write(0);
pinMode(redLed, OUTPUT);
pinMode(greenLed, OUTPUT);
digitalWrite(redLed, LOW);
digitalWrite(greenLed, LOW);
}
void loop() {
char key = keypad.getKey();
if(key != NO_KEY){
attempt += key;
lcd.setCursor(lenght,1);
lcd.print("*");
++lenght;
}
if(lenght == 4){
lcd.clear();
lcd.setCursor(0,0);
if(attempt == code){
digitalWrite(greenLed, HIGH);
lcd.print("Code Correct");
//Tourner le cerveau moteur de 180 apres le retourner a 0
for(int i = 0 ; i <= 180 ; i++){
monCerveau.write(i);
delay(15);
}
delay(2000);
for(int i = 180 ; i >= 0 ; i--){
monCerveau.write(i);
delay(15);
}
delay(1000);
digitalWrite(greenLed, LOW);
}else{
digitalWrite(redLed, HIGH);
lcd.setCursor(0, 0);
lcd.print("Code Incorrect");
delay(3000);
digitalWrite(redLed, LOW);
}
attempt = "";
lenght = 0;
lcd.clear();
lcd.setCursor(0,0);
lcd.print("Password : ");
}
}
